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Southwick to Seascale start from as little as £49.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Southwick to Seascale start from £128.30 one way, or £183.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Southwick to Seascale are available for £240.60 one way, or £481.20 return

Facilities and Amenities at Southwick Station

Southwick station is equipped with an accessible ticket office, operational from 06:40 to 13:15 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 08:10 to 15:45 on Sundays. For those who prefer self-service, you can buy and collect tickets using the available ticket machines, which also support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While the station itself offers partial step-free access via steep ramps, always check the station map for detailed layout information.

Supporting passengers of all abilities, Southwick station has induction loops and accessible ticket machines. You can find staff assistance during ticket office hours, and help points are strategically placed on platforms for any immediate queries. While luggage storage is not a facility at Southwick, you can rest assured knowing there's CCTV coverage for added security.

Facilities at Seascale Station

When it comes to ease of travel, Seascale station covers the basics efficiently. While there is no manned ticket office, ticket machines are readily available for collecting tickets purchased online. The station is equipped with induction loops and accessible ticket machines to aid hearing-impaired passengers. A point worth noting is that there are no CCTV cameras for added surveillance or facilities like toilets and refreshment services. Planning ahead for these needs would be wise.

Despite being a Category B station with step-free access, some passengers might find the platform height challenging. However, assistance from conductors and accessible ramps for boarding are provided, ensuring ease of use for everyone.

Getting Around Seascale

Seascale station is well-connected with various transport modes, allowing travelers to easily navigate the local area. Although taxi services aren't available directly at the station, they can be booked through Cab4You. As for immediate travel, the rail replacement service conveniently operates right from the station front.

Public transport is also catered for with local bus services, and any inquiries can be addressed via their helpline at 0871 200 2233. While bicycle hire is not available at the station, cyclists can safely park at Platform 2.
